Lisbon, the capital city of Portugal, is not only known for its picturesque views, historic sites, and vibrant culture but also for its architectural landscape. In recent years, Lisbon has become a hotspot for businesses looking to set up shop in Europe, attracting a diverse range of industries from tech startups to financial services. However, with the allure of this beautiful city also comes the need for businesses to be aware of and comply with local legal regulations.

Navigating legal compliance in Lisbon, Portugal, especially in terms of business operations and architecture, is crucial for organizations looking to establish a presence in the city. Understanding the legal framework related to zoning regulations, building codes, permits, and other compliance requirements is essential to avoid any legal pitfalls that may arise. One of the important aspects of legal compliance in architecture-related businesses in Lisbon is ensuring adherence to the city's urban planning and preservation regulations. As a city with a rich historical background and significant architectural heritage, Lisbon places a strong emphasis on the preservation of its historic buildings and urban landscape. Businesses involved in architecture, construction, or renovation projects must be mindful of these regulations to ensure that their projects align with the city's aesthetic and cultural values. Furthermore, businesses operating in Lisbon must also be familiar with local laws and regulations governing business activities, taxation, employment practices, and other legal aspects. Ensuring compliance with these regulations not only helps businesses avoid legal penalties but also fosters a positive reputation and trust within the local community and among potential clients. Partnering with legal professionals or consultants who have expertise in business law and architectural regulations in Lisbon can provide businesses with the necessary guidance and support to navigate the complexities of legal compliance. These experts can help businesses understand and fulfill their legal obligations while also exploring opportunities for growth and expansion within the city. In conclusion, while Lisbon's architecture and business landscape offer exciting opportunities for organizations, it is important to prioritize legal compliance to ensure long-term success and sustainability. By being aware of and proactively addressing legal requirements, businesses can thrive in this dynamic city while contributing to its cultural and economic ecosystem. Whether you are a seasoned business owner or a budding entrepreneur looking to establish your presence in Lisbon, understanding and prioritizing legal compliance will be key to your success in this vibrant and bustling city.
